A burglar caught after a tip off from the public has been jailed for two years.
Officers arrested Patrick Horeatko after being called to reports of men acting suspiciously in Elmwood Road, Croydon.
During his police interview after being arrested for cannabis, he admitted burgling a home in Old Town, Croydon, and stealing laptops, Apple gadgets, bracelets, game consoles and a jewellery box.
He also admitted burgling a restaurant in Lower Addiscombe Road, Croydon, and stealing £200 from the till.
The 25-year-old, of no fixed abode, was sentenced at Croydon Crown Court on July 17 after pleading guilty to burglary.
